carry one's (own) weight & pull one's (own) weight
Fig. to do one's share; to earn one's keep. (The

weight

is the burden that is the responsibility of someone.) •

Tom, you must be more helpful around the house. We each have to carry our own weight.

Bill, I'm afraid that you can't work here anymore. You just haven't been carrying your weight.
